#13142f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13142f is composed of 7.5% red, 7.8%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.6% cyan, 57.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 81.6% black. It has a hue angle of 237.9 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 12.9%. #13142f color hex could be obtained by blending #26285e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#13142f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020205 is the darkest color, while #f6f6fb is the lightest one.
